The people at Reynolds Kitchens, the company responsible for Reynolds Wrap aluminum foil, parchment paper, bakeware, and sandwich bags (among other products), have shown off their sick sense of humor a week before Thanksgiving.

A section of the company’s website devoted to recipes has apparently been taken over by someone with ties to Frito-Lay, because Reynolds wants you to coat your turkey with Flamin’ Hot Cheetos, Cool Ranch Doritos, or Funyuns this year.

Of course, they provided recipes for these concoctions, which sound like the most disgusting things ever. The recipes can really be boiled down to “crush the snack items and use them to coat the turkey as if they’re breadcrumbs.”
